Hello guys gals and nonbinary pals, and welcome to another episode of Game Closet where we talk to all sorts of cool queer & LGBT+ tabletop rpg folks! In this episode I talk to Alana Cheski of Witches Ladder Games about the cool games you can get from them. We also talk a little bit about conflict mediation, embracing anxieties at the table, and which monster we’d most like to spend the night with. It’s a really great episode & I can’t wait for you to enjoy it. Game Closet: interviewing LGBT+ people in tabletop gaming, creators, fans, anyone! Interviews would talk about personal experiences, games with (or without) LGBT+ representations or themes, or using queer content in gaming.
